Wie schaut ihr euch um? Ich würd mir gerne die WW2OL / IL2 Style Snapviews mappen, aber es scheint nicht zu gehen.
Sicht Steuerung
-
-
Track IR ........das wird der beste Kauf deines Lebens sein....... in Sachen zocken
-
stimmt wohl.
dazu gibts auch schon paar andere freds hier im forum.
wird aber eigentlich mal zeit das es konkurenz gibt, deren berechtigte überheblichkeit stört mich etwas.
-
Das war nicht sehr hilfreich, aber ich habe eine Lösung gefunden:
glovepie +
Code- // numlock views ver 1.1
- // set 0 if you want numpad views
- var.use_hat = 0
- if var.use_hat = 1
- //joystick2 hat views
- // set view UP button
- var.up = keyboard.NumPad5
- var.forward_up = joystick2.Pov1Up AND NOT joystick2.Pov1Right AND NOT joystick2.Pov1Left
- var.forward_right = joystick2.Pov1Right AND joystick2.Pov1Up
- var.right = joystick2.Pov1Right AND NOT joystick2.Pov1Up AND NOT joystick2.Pov1Down
- var.back_right = joystick2.Pov1Right AND joystick2.Pov1Down
- var.back = joystick2.Pov1Down AND NOT joystick2.Pov1Right AND NOT joystick2.Pov1Left
- var.left = joystick2.Pov1Left AND NOT joystick2.Pov1Up AND NOT joystick2.Pov1Down
- var.back_left = joystick2.Pov1Left AND joystick2.Pov1Down
- var.forward_left = joystick2.Pov1Left AND joystick2.Pov1Up
- else if var.use_numpad = 1
- //define view keys
- //numpad views
- var.forward_up = keyboard.NumPad8
- var.forward_right = keyboard.NumPad9
- var.right = keyboard.NumPad6
- var.back_right = keyboard.NumPad3
- var.back = keyboard.NumPad2
- var.left = keyboard.NumPad4
- var.back_left = keyboard.NumPad1
- var.forward_left = keyboard.NumPad7
- var.up = keyboard.NumPad5
- else
- var.up = keyboard.NumPad5
- var.forward_up = (joystick2.Pov1Up AND NOT joystick2.Pov1Right AND NOT joystick2.Pov1Left) OR keyboard.NumPad8
- var.forward_right = (joystick2.Pov1Right AND joystick2.Pov1Up) OR keyboard.NumPad9
- var.right = (joystick1.Pov1Right AND NOT joystick2.Pov1Up AND NOT joystick2.Pov1Down) OR keyboard.NumPad6
- var.back_right = (joystick2.Pov1Right AND joystick2.Pov1Down) OR keyboard.NumPad3
- var.back = (joystick2.Pov1Down AND NOT joystick2.Pov1Right AND NOT joystick2.Pov1Left) OR keyboard.NumPad2
- var.left = (joystick2.Pov1Left AND NOT joystick2.Pov1Up AND NOT joystick2.Pov1Down) OR keyboard.NumPad4
- var.back_left = (joystick2.Pov1Left AND joystick2.Pov1Down) OR keyboard.NumPad1
- var.forward_left = (joystick2.Pov1Left AND joystick2.Pov1Up) OR keyboard.NumPad7
- endif
- FakeTrackIR.y = 0
- FakeTrackIR.z = 0
- FakeTrackIR.x = 0
- FakeTrackIR.yaw = 0
- FakeTrackIR.pitch = 0
- if var.up = 1
- if var.forward or var.forward_right or var.right or var.back_right or var.back or var.left or var.back_left or var.forward_left or var.forward_up
- FakeTrackIR.pitch = 45
- else
- FakeTrackIR.pitch = 80
- endif
- endif
- if var.forward = 1
- FakeTrackIR.yaw = 0
- FakeTrackIR.pitch = 0
- elsif var.forward_right = 1
- FakeTrackIR.yaw = 45
- elsif var.right = 1
- FakeTrackIR.yaw = 90
- elsif var.back_right = 1
- FakeTrackIR.yaw = 150
- elsif var.back = 1
- FakeTrackIR.yaw = 150
- elsif var.back_left = 1
- FakeTrackIR.yaw = -150
- elsif var.left = 1
- FakeTrackIR.yaw = -90
- elsif var.forward_left = 1
- FakeTrackIR.yaw = -45
- endif